调研速递|中石化石油机械接受全体投资者调研,聚焦账款、订单等要点
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2025-08-26 11:16
Core Viewpoint - The company held a semi-annual performance briefing for 2025, emphasizing its commitment to improving accounts receivable management and enhancing operational performance to benefit shareholders [1][2][3]. Accounts Receivable Management and Cash Flow - The company has implemented a specialized action plan for accounts receivable management from 2025 to 2027, focusing on reducing existing receivables, improving quality, and controlling new receivables [2]. - Cash received from sales and services increased by 530 million yuan year-on-year in the first half of 2025 [2]. Corporate Responsibility and Commitment to Shareholders - As a state-owned enterprise, the company emphasizes its responsibility towards national energy security and shareholder interests, aiming to enhance operational performance through advanced technology and integrated solutions [3]. - The company is committed to high-end, intelligent, green, and service-oriented development, particularly in drilling tools and equipment [3]. Orders and Business Development - In the first half of 2025, the company achieved an order volume of 4.94 billion yuan, a 14% increase year-on-year [4]. - Specific segments include 1.8 billion yuan for oil drilling equipment, 550 million yuan for drilling tools, 900 million yuan for steel pipes, and 350 million yuan for gathering equipment [4]. - The hydrogen energy equipment segment saw new orders of 75 million yuan, a 21% increase, reflecting the company's active participation in the hydrogen energy industry [4]. - International orders reached 1.21 billion yuan, marking a 15% increase, with significant orders from markets in Asia and Africa [4]. Other Key Points - The company is enhancing production capabilities by introducing robotic welding lines for manufacturing processes [5]. - The increase in accounts receivable is attributed to varying settlement cycles for different products, alongside strict credit management policies [5]. - The company aims to achieve its annual operational targets and is considering stock incentive goals based on peer comparisons [5]. - The company has won a bid for the Daye cavern hydrogen storage project, with the contract currently in the signing process [5].
